Onboarding note for the Ledgerpane admin table: bulk edits are applied through the batcher service, not directly against the database. Select rows, choose an action, and the batcher stages changes in a pending set you can review before commit. Edits over 500 rows require a second approver — this is enforced server-side, so don't try to chunk around it. To run the batcher locally you need the staging write credential, which goes in your .env as the next line.

secret setting of bahip-kagag: RELAY_SECRET3=c83

Release checklist — Verdalune plant-watering scheduler, step 7 of 11. Confirm the valve-timing migration ran cleanly on the staging pods before promoting. Check that no schedules reference the deprecated moisture-threshold field; the migration should have rewritten them all. If any remain, halt and page the Fernwick data lead rather than editing rows by hand. Once staging looks clean, promote the artifact and record it. The build token to record is below.

pipeline stamp: htk31_f769b577b3028a4e9958e5bb8d1259a

### Item 14 — Serverless cold starts

Check that every Quillbase handler declares a warm-pool size and that the init path stays under the 800 ms budget. We got burned last quarter when a dependency bump quietly doubled cold-start times on the invoice lambdas — nobody noticed until the Harwick launch. Reviewers: flag any new top-level imports or synchronous config fetches in handler init. If the budget can't be met, the exception needs written approval from the owner identified below.

account owner for bawip-fajeg: Ralix Oliwyn

**Night Shift — Recording Studio (Room 4B)**

The Fennick Media training studio runs unattended overnight. Check the booking sheet before entering. Power down lights and teleprompter after any maintenance. Do not move camera rigs; they are marked on the floor. Report faults in the night log, not by phone. Lock the equipment cage before leaving. The studio door uses a keypad; enter with the code below.

badge for fahap-kahof: bdg-EQUNTN-00774017